TITLE:数値を切り上げる関数
*数値を切り上げる関数 [#r43c26ac]
**数値を任意の桁で切り上げる [#a0d01aa4]
数値を任意の桁で切り上げるには、「&color(Red){ROUNDUP関数};」を使います。
>
:ROUNDUP(指定された桁数で切り上げる)|
--書式 : ROUNDUP(数値, 桁数)
--引数 : 数値 : 切り上げ対象となる数値
--引数 : 桁数 : 数値を切り上げ結果の桁数
---0か省略なら、最も近い整数に切り上げ
---正の整数なら、数値は小数点の右 (小数点以下) の指定した桁に切り上げ
---負の整数なら、数値は小数点の左 (整数部分) の指定した桁 (1 の位を 0 とする) に切り上げ
:例:C8セルの数値を小数点以下1桁まで表示するように、小数点以下第2位で切り上げる|
#pre(novervatim){{
=COLOR(red):ROUNDUPCOLOR(black):(C8,1)
}}
<
***ROUND・ROUNDDOWN・ROUNDUP関数の「桁数」について [#h7d00df8]
これらの関数で指定する「桁数」は、次のようなことを表します。
-正の値であれば、小数点以下第何位までの数値にするか
-負の数であれば、1の位や10の位等の数値をどこまで0にするか
これらを表にすると、次のようになります。
|CENTER:|LEFT:|RIGHT:|c
|CENTER:~桁数|CENTER:~計算結果|CENTER:~例(12345.6789の切り捨て)|
|3|小数点以下第3位まで|12345.678|
|2|小数点以下第2位まで|12345.67|
|1|小数点以下第1位まで|12345.6|
|0|1の位まで|12345|
|-1|10の位まで|12340|
|-2|100の位まで|12300|
|-3|1000の位まで|12000|
**小テスト分の点数の計算 [#ke86359d]
&br;
&navi2(2009/8th,next);進んでください。
----
#navi2(2009/8th,prev,toc,next)
|